This top level file has been removed from the Puppeteer package. The same data is exposed via puppeteer.errors, so swap to that:
// before
const errors = require('puppeteer/Errors');
// after
const puppeteer = require('puppeteer');
const errors = puppeteer.errors
Behind the scenes
We've continued our drive to migrate to a new documentation system using TSDoc. These docs are available in the new-docs directory on GitHub. These aren't ready for use just yet but we're making great progress. You can track this work in #6118.
We've continued improving our TypeScript definitions. Our tests are now migrated to TypeScript (#5830) so that we're consuming our own API. Work continues to ship built-in type definitions in a future version. You can track this work in #6124.
We've started restructuring Puppeteer to work towards being able to better support an environment agnostic Puppeteer module. You can track this work in #6125.
